Understanding the Material Properties

One of the first pain points customers encounter is understanding the specific properties of 304 stainless steel. This material is known for its excellent corrosion resistance, making it ideal for outdoor and high-humidity applications. However, many buyers do not fully grasp the importance of these properties.

For example, 304 stainless steel is composed of 18% chromium and 8% nickel. This unique blend provides not just corrosion resistance but also enhances the alloy’s ability to withstand acids and high temperatures. If a customer were to mistakenly purchase a lower-grade stainless steel, they might experience rusting or degradation in just a few months, leading to costly repairs and project delays.

Quantifying Your Needs

Another common issue is customers misjudging the quantity of material they need. Without a precise calculation, you might either underorder, causing project interruptions, or overorder, leading to unnecessary expenses.

A case study from a mid-sized architectural firm revealed that they underestimated their requirements by 25%, which not only delayed their project but also forced them to pay a premium price for rushed orders. To avoid this, it is essential to work closely with your project manager or contractor to develop an accurate estimate of the amount of steel needed.

How to Calculate Your Needs

Start by measuring the area where the stainless steel will be applied. For example, if you need to cover a wall that is 10 feet wide and 8 feet high, you will need:

  • 10 ft × 8 ft = 80 square feet of material

Next, remember to account for seams or overlaps, often adding an additional 10% to your total. This way, you ensure that you have enough material while minimizing waste.

Selecting the Right Supplier

The supplier you choose significantly impacts the quality and delivery of your 304 stainless steel coils. A widespread issue is customers selecting suppliers based solely on price, overlooking the quality and sourcing of the materials. Low-quality steel not only jeopardizes the integrity of your architectural work but can also lead to costly compliance issues down the line.

According to industry data, projects using lower-grade materials have a 20% higher likelihood of requiring repairs within the first two years. Look for suppliers that provide certifications verifying the quality of their stainless steel. ISO 9001, for example, is a standard that indicates good quality management practices.

Verifying Supplier Claims

Before finalizing your purchase, request samples and ask for references from previous customers. A reputable supplier will be more than willing to show you the quality of their products and provide you with feedback from clients who have used the coils in architectural projects.
